Prince Harry is offering his Invictus Games family some virtual support! The 35-year-old Duke of Sussex shared a special video message over the weekend, noting that the 2020 Invictus Games had been set to kick off this weekend prior to the coronavirus outbreak. «We should have also been gathering together in the Netherlands to kick start the Invictus Games 2020 in The Hague,» Harry explained. «Life has changed dramatically for all of us since I was last in The Hague.» Harry, who has been a founder and patron of the Invictus Games since 2014, went on to praise the wounded, injured, and sick veterans and their families who participate in the games. «I hope all those in the Invictus family are coping well and supporting each other through this
